PLAYGROUND There are 87 children at a playground. There are 23 more boys than girls. How many of each are at the playground?

Mathematics
1 answer:
UNO [17]4 years ago
3 0

Answer:

G=32 B=55

Step-by-step explanation:

55+32=87
